Checking Valve Clearance - KF82
What is the process for checking valve clearance? Do you have to remove side cover from engine or do you check through valve spring inspection cover?

Re: Checking Valve Clearance - KF82
Here's a blowup of the motor assembly. I never had to check valve clearance on any of my motors. The valves are positioned next to the piston, so there's no piston-to-valve clearance measurement to worry about (flathead motor). If you're worried about the valves hitting the top cover of the cylinder head (#15 in the diagram) you can easily remove it and check things out.

Re: Checking Valve Clearance - KF82
I'm sure he means lash when closed. He needs the spec for that and maybe a procedure. This should be measured at TDC on the compression stroke. Not sure how the spec reads (cold or hot)

Re: Checking Valve Clearance - KF82
Thanks. Yes I was referring to valve clearance....i think spec is .004 to .008. I was wondering HOW you adjust it. Seems like it's just different size tappet caps, which means removing the side cover.

Re: Checking Valve Clearance - KF82
They didn't make different size tappet caps. You just had to put the motor togather with the new ones and then sand them down until the right clearance. Why are you worried about the valve clearance. Once set there ususally on for ever. The rivets in the cam gear usually come loose before the cam tappets wear out.

Re: Checking Valve Clearance - KF82
They make different size caps. You usually adjust this when you assemble the engine. The easiest way to change them is unbolt the jug and slide it up a little. All done through valve cover hole.
